As the cultural behemoth that is BBC Radio 4's daily, flagship, arts and culture review show prepares to celebrate its 20th birthday it expands across the airwaves onto television. Each week a presenter will be joined in the studio by guests to cast a critical eye over the week in the arts world and by musical guests performing live in the studio. Each edition of the show will feature a rich mix of interviews, reviews, previews, news, features and performances from across a broad spectrum of art-forms.
